o Sperm production increases with age in the postpubertal period and is
subject to seasonal changes in many species.
o Castration of prepubertal males suppresses sexual development.
Regressive changes in behavior and structure take place following
castration of adult males. Castration is a standard procedure in animal
husbandry to modify aggressive male behavior and to eliminate
undesirable carcass qualities, e.g., boar taint.

The Epididymis and Ductus Deferens
o The epididymis is the first excretory organ of the male genital system.
o The epididymis is attached to the testicle and consists of the ductuli
efferentes and the ductus epididymidis, surrounded by the testicular
albuginea.
o The ductus epididymidis is very tortuous and extremely long in all
species. On the lateral aspect of the testicle, between it and the
epididymis, a large space is outlined under the name of testicular bursa.
o The epididymis has a head, a body, and a tail.
o The caput epididymidis (head), in which a variable number of efferent
ductules join the duct of the epididymis. It forms a flattened structure
applied to one pole of the testis.
o The narrow corpus epididymidis (body) terminates at the opposite pole
in the expanded cauda epididymidis (tail).
